Which ViewLux Models This Applies To

ViewLux builds several door lines, but the hardware we service most in Fort Myers falls into two groups: the sliding glass patio doors (most commonly the 6000 and 8000 series) and the hinged French-door units found on older McGregor Boulevard and Cape Coral canal homes. The roller assemblies differ between series, so before you order anything, open the door and look at the bottom edge. The roller housing usually carries a stamped code, often a two-letter prefix followed by four digits. If the stamp is gone, measure the door slab thickness in millimeters. The 6000 series runs a 5.8 mm roller axle; the 8000 series uses 8 mm hardware. That single measurement tells us which part your door actually needs, and it’s the difference between a door that rolls like new and a part that fights the track from day one.

On the OEM-versus-aftermarket question, we’ll be straight with you. ViewLux’s OEM rollers use a nylon wheel over a steel bearing. On Fort Myers canal-front homes, salt air and morning condensation cut bearing life noticeably; we stock a stainless-bearing aftermarket equivalent for most 6000-series doors that outlasts the OEM part by two to three years for roughly $18 more per roller. If you’re on a freshwater inland lot, the OEM part holds up fine. We quote both on paper so you can see the difference before you pay for it. Signs Your ViewLux Door Installation Is Failing

  • The door drags or sticks at one point along the track. Usually this is a flat-spotted roller or a bent axle. The wheel stops rolling and starts grinding, which scores the aluminum track and turns a $40 roller job into a $300 track replacement if ignored.
  • The handle lifts but the latch doesn’t fully retract. ViewLux’s internal latch springs are small and fatigue after years of Florida heat cycling. The handle feels loose first, then the door won’t open from inside without wiggling.
  • The door sits low on one corner and rubs the frame. The roller height adjustment screw has backed out, or the roller has collapsed entirely. If you can see daylight under the door only at one end, it’s a roller issue, not a frame issue.
  • The door is harder to lock each season. This is a frame-alignment symptom. Fort Myers slab homes settle, and a door that was square in 2006 may be out of true by 2026. The lock keeper plate drifts, and the mechanism binds.
  • You hear a gritty, scraping sound when the door moves. That is the bearing failing, and it is sending metal dust into the roller. Once the bearing is gone, the wheel scores the track. We tell Fort Myers homeowners to treat that sound the way you’d treat a grinding brake caliper: deal with it now, not next month.

Replacement Cost & What’s Included

A ViewLux roller replacement in Fort Myers typically runs $145 to $260 per door, including both rollers, track cleaning, and height adjustment. A complete handle and latch assembly runs $180 to $320 installed. A full hinge rebuild on a French door runs $340 to $480. The range depends on whether you have the 6000 or 8000 series, whether we use OEM or the stainless-bearing aftermarket option, and whether the track needs dressing. We quote the parts and labor as separate line items on paper before we touch the door, so you know exactly what you’re paying for. DIY or Call Us?

What an owner can safely do: check the roller stamps, clean the track with a dry brush, and test whether the door is level using a two-foot level on the bottom rail. What you should not do: pull the door panel out of the frame. A ViewLux sliding glass panel weighs 120 to 180 pounds depending on the glass package. If it tips while it’s out, it takes the glass with it, and now you have a $600 problem instead of a $200 one. We’ve also corrected more than one homeowner repair where the wrong roller was forced into the housing and seized against the track within a week.
